Ok well i went to o railys and they have a weatherstrip in three different sizes that will work and also they say i need some window adhesive stuff.But is it better to go with the butyl tape?
 
Yes just the tape. Make sure you clean both surfaces well, remove old tape/residue, before applying the tape and putting the window back in or I guarantee it will leak again.
 
Yesterday we had a lot of driving rain here in Wisconsin and my rear sliding window leaked real bad (more than it had in the past and its not the brake light) and I think its time to replace the butyl tape. I have an extended cab and understand this is what the factory used.

Does anyone know what size (diameter) tape is best? Amazon sells the 3M Windo-Weld brand in 1/4", 5/16" and 3/8" sizes. I'm thinking 5/16" would work, but I want to check with you guys and see what anyone else had used.
